This Thursday the Pink Dot Rally organizers announced that they welcome the police advisory and the spokesperson for the Pink Dot Organising Committee released a full statement which reflected that the accepted the advisory and have no problem in staying within the legal boundaries.

The statement said: “Pink Dot welcomes the Police’s advisory related to Pink Dot 2014, which is set to take place on Saturday, June 28, 2014, at Speakers’ Corner at Hong Lim Park. Pink Dot strives to be an all-inclusive event that celebrates diversity and the freedom to love in a peaceful, positive manner. Over the past five years, we have endeavored to stay within the law, and acceded to the rules and regulations of the Speakers’ Corner, without incident. This year’s event will be no different. We have taken all measures to ensure a good event experience for our participants and community partners. These include deploying over a hundred volunteers to manage crowds and help to keep the park clean; first aid teams and doctors are on standby; and for the first time, security personnel will be deployed to assist our crews with crowd control and to manage any unruly behavior taking place at the park.”

It further added: “Pink Dot remains an event that welcomes one and all to share in our common love for one another, and our common love for Singapore. We invite all Singaporeans who support the Freedom to Love to join us in a peaceful expression of inclusivity, meet with community groups that are doing their part to support Singapore’s LGBT community, listen to members of the community voice their thoughts on a range of topics, and enjoy a concert by our local talents.”
